The King of All Instruments
The piano has a royal personality that offers the softest, most delicate music to the most thunderous soundtrack. There is a magical quality to its sound - breadth, and depth that can capture the full range of human emotion. Today, this fascinating rhythmic enigma, the piano, is renowned as the ''King of All Instruments.''
''Keys of Beauty'' is EverSound's tribute to such special instrument.
The collection showcases the majestic and subtle qualities of the piano sounds as expressed by an ensemble of EverSound artists, with contributions from special guests and talented new artists.

Press Quotes
'Solo piano is becoming more and more popular these days. It is perfect as background music in almost any context, especially at the modern workplace, where few workers have an office of their own and may need headphones to block out noises. The sound of the piano can be both relaxing and inspiring. It soothes the brain and reduces stress. Including pieces by some of the finest artists in the New Age music genre - John Adorney, Michele McLaughlin and Suzanne Ciani - this collection shows why the piano is the most versatile instrument. Played by such talented and accomplished artists, its beauty resonates within us on a deep and intimate level.'
—BT Fasmer, New Age Music Guide
